Gwangju Institute of Science and Technology (GIST) is a leading research-oriented university located in Gwangju, South Korea. Known for its focus on science and technology, GIST encourages innovation and academic excellence. The institute is dedicated to advancing knowledge through cutting-edge research and offers a wide range of programs in science, engineering, and technology.

How to Enroll
Follow these steps to apply GIST | Gwangju Institute of Science and Technology
Create an account
Create your account in the online application system
Online application
Fill out the online application and don't forget to write down the application number, which is automatically generated during registration. * It is important to enter your recommender's email address correctly. In order for your recommender to send a letter of recommendation, they must use the exact same email address that you provided in your application.
Request for a letter of recommendation
Ask your recommender to send a letter of recommendation. He/she will need your application number to create an account in the referral system.
Uploading documents
Upload the required documents into the application system and click the [Submission] button before the application deadline. You will be able to submit your application only after all required documents have been uploaded and the letter of recommendation has been sent by your recommender.
Check request status
After submitting your application, please check your email at least once a day to see if GIST has requested an interview or additional documents.
Getting a response
Check your final admission result in the online application system on the day of admission announcement.
Registration
Completion of enrollment requires submission of documents to GIST. If you decide to accept the offer of admission, you must register with GIST within the specified deadline. The original high school diploma certified by an apostille (or consulate) and other documents requested by GIST must be mailed to the Admissions Office. After this procedure, you will receive a certificate of enrollment and other documents for applying for a visa.
Obtaining a visa
The visa application process for students from Kazakhstan planning to study in Korea involves several main steps. First of all, applicants need a passport valid for at least 6 months. They must fill out a visa application form, attach a current color photograph (3.5 x 4.5 cm), and provide a copy of the personal information page of the passport. To obtain a long-term visa for more than 90 days, applicants must undergo a tuberculosis test (fluorography/PCR test) at an approved clinic within the last 3 months. A certificate of enrollment from the chosen educational institution in original or a copy is required. An academic transcript, such as an original document from the last educational institution with an English translation, must be provided. In addition, a bank statement with a live seal issued within the last 2 weeks confirming financial capacity is required. The required amount varies depending on the type of program and place of residence. Students who are pursuing a bachelor's or master's degree in Seoul, Incheon or Gyeonggi need to present $20,000. For students from other cities, the amount is $18,000. The visa application processing period is about 14 working days, excluding weekends and holidays, the consular fee is $90, paid in cash.
